    This used to be how many games were and I have a few capable of it.
    Some older ones from about 2005 and earlier has this feature, I can name the original COD through COD2 at least and a really old one, Jane's WWII Fighters (Circa 1998) with this capability.
    Load it up, let whomever else will be in know what the IP will be for you hosting the game and go for it.

    With games around 2006 and later this began to die off because of Steam and Valve coming to be as online services, if you wanted to go online with your buds after that then it's login through either one and play while paying them to do the same thing you could have done yourself for free before.

    In the case of something that's an MMO or just a really large game period, it makes sense to have a dedicated server so you don't have to pony up for all that in terms of hardware/local storage but they swept it all under the same "Pay-Rug" you play under these days.

    You're unlikely to be able to just upgrade a laptop. You'd be a lot better just buying a newish one, than buying an older one and trying to upgrade it. If you did manage to find one that is even upgradeable (usually the CPU is soldered to the motherboard), the cooling system probably wouldn't be able to keep the chip cool - That's a 65w chip, so keeping that cool in a laptop would be awkward. Battery life would be practically non-existent too.
